Murder accused remanded

The man accused of the shooting death of a St George father was remanded when he appeared in the District “A” Magistrates’ Court yesterday.
Evanson DeCoursey Armstrong, 36 (at left), who has no fixed place of abode, was not required to plead to murdering Elvin Thomas on June 25.
Magistrate Deborah Holder remanded him to HMP Dodds and adjourned the matter until August 13.
